Don't get them to change X! I'm making a reasonable living fixing things for people who want a Cinemascope display under X (geologists, meterologists, etc. etc.). Seriously, folks, the Cinemascope approach and the existing X approach seem to be so totally at odds with each other that trying to fudge it with a server extension would stand a good chance of making things worse for everybody. The stuff I do lets you choose at server startup time and that's IT. I do have a research window server that has all this stuff built in from the foundations, and its internal structure is quite different to anything you've seen in either X or NeWS. This implies doing Cinemascope as anything other than a hack reuiqres a total rewrite and subsequent bug infestation. -- Ian D.
